Job Description: The Government Compliance Analyst II supports the organization’s government compliance program by assisting in the implementation and monitoring of policies and controls aligned with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R),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ement (DFARS), and Cost Accounting Standards (CAS). This role operates as a generalist within the compliance function, partnering with cross-functional teams such as finance, contracts, supply chain, and legal to ensure adherence to applicable regulatory requirements. The analyst contributes to internal reviews, documentation efforts, training initiatives, reporting, and continuous improvement of compliance processes.
